The challenges surrounding the Industrial Internet of Things (IIoT) evaluation and adoption are significant. Security, interoperability, connectivity and other issues have deterred many companies from making hard investments. As with any developmental technology, some business leaders are simply waiting for others to do the experiments (and incur the costs of mistakes) before making any investments themselves. In contrast, first movers are looking to gain valuable knowledge and a competitive advantage that could make it difficult for followers to catch up.

This research report -- initiated by IndustryWeek and Genpact Research Institute, with support from GE Digital and the Industrial Internet Consortium -- reviews manufacturers’ current perspectives and applications of IIoT technology as a key indicator of its immediate direction and potential.
